South Carolina beach homes face turtle-safe lighting warnings, but violations surface after dark

Summary by thecooldown.com
On South Carolina's Waccamaw Neck, sea turtle nesting season is once again running into problems caused by beachfront lighting. Conservation advocates say repeated warnings still haven't convinced dozens of oceanfront properties to follow rules designated to protect endangered hatchlings.
